"Meanwhile" is the one hundred and fortieth episode of Futurama, the twenty-sixth and last of the seventh production season and the thirteenth and last of the tenth broadcast season. It will also serve as the last episode of Futurama. [2]

The episode will be the second part of a two-part episode that has a single plot spanning over two episodes. [citation needed]

In 2012, Futurama writer Eric Rogers made two revelations concerning the episode. On 11 April, he revealed that "["7ACV25" and this episode] now [had] stories". [3] On 20 April, he revealed that the episode was being "[pitched] out" and urged fans to buy merchandise in order for the show to "come back". [4]

In 2013, the episode was revealed to be the potential series finale, the last episode of Season 7, and the second part of the Season 7B two-parter.

On 22 April, it was announced that Futurama had not been renewed for an eight season, making this the series finale.
